Keto Beef and Cabbage Stir-Fry Recipe

A flavorful and nutrient-packed Keto Beef and Cabbage Stir-Fry that’s perfect for a low-carb, high-protein meal. This quick and easy dish combines ground beef, crisp cabbage, and savory seasonings for a satisfying stir-fry with a slight kick of heat.

Ingredients

Scale

Meat and Vegetables

  • 1 lb ground beef
  • 1 small head of cabbage, thinly sliced
  • 1 small onion, thinly sliced
  • 2 cloves garlic, minced

Seasonings and Sauces

  • 2 tablespoons soy sauce (or coconut aminos for a soy-free option)
  • 1 tablespoon apple cider vinegar
  • 1 teaspoon ground ginger
  • 1/2 teaspoon red pepper flakes (optional)
  • Salt and pepper to taste

Oils

  • 2 tablespoons olive oil or avocado oil

Instructions

  1. Heat the oil: Warm 2 tablespoons of olive oil or avocado oil in a large skillet over medium-high heat to prepare for cooking the beef and vegetables.
  2. Cook the beef: Add the ground beef to the hot skillet and cook until browned, breaking it into smaller pieces with a spoon as it cooks to ensure even browning and texture.
  3. Sauté onion and garlic: Mix in the thinly sliced onion and minced garlic, cooking for 2-3 minutes until the onion becomes translucent and fragrant.
  4. Add cabbage: Stir in the thinly sliced cabbage and cook for about 5-7 minutes, allowing it to soften slightly while still retaining some crunch.
  5. Season the stir-fry: Pour in the soy sauce (or coconut aminos), apple cider vinegar, ground ginger, and sprinkle the red pepper flakes, salt, and pepper. Stir everything thoroughly to combine the flavors evenly.
  6. Finish cooking: Continue cooking for an additional 5 minutes or until the cabbage is tender and the flavors have melded together perfectly.
  7. Serve: Remove from heat and serve the stir-fry hot for a delicious, low-carb meal.

Notes

  • Use coconut aminos instead of soy sauce for a soy-free, gluten-free alternative.
  • Adjust red pepper flakes according to your preferred spice level or omit for a milder dish.
  • Can be garnished with chopped green onions or sesame seeds for added flavor and texture.
  • Leftovers can be stored in an airtight container in the refrigerator for up to 3 days.
  • For extra fat, add a tablespoon of butter or ghee near the end of cooking.
